1991 Buick Century vs. 2012 Ford Mondeo

To start off, 2012 Ford Mondeo is newer by 21 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1991 Buick Century.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1991 Buick Century would be higher. At 3,300 cc (6 cylinders), 1991 Buick Century is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1991 Buick Century (161 HP) has 2 more horse power than 2012 Ford Mondeo. (159 HP). In normal driving conditions, 1991 Buick Century should accelerate faster than 2012 Ford Mondeo.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1991 Buick Century (251 Nm) has 43 more torque (in Nm) than 2012 Ford Mondeo. (208 Nm). This means 1991 Buick Century will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2012 Ford Mondeo.

Compare all specifications:

1991 Buick Century 2012 Ford Mondeo
Make Buick Ford
Model Century Mondeo
Year Released 1991 2012
Body Type Sedan Station Wagon
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 3300 cc 2261 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 5 cylinders
Engine Type V in-line
Horse Power 161 HP 159 HP
Torque 251 Nm 208 Nm
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line - Premium
Drive Type Front Front
Transmission Type Automatic Automatic
Number of Seats 5 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 4 doors 5 doors
Vehicle Length 4803 mm 4840 mm
Vehicle Width 1763 mm 1890 mm
Vehicle Height 1364 mm 1520 mm
Wheelbase Size 2662 mm 2860 mm
